How can I set the text of a WPF Hyperlink via data binding?

This worked for me in a "Page".

<TextBlock>
    <Hyperlink NavigateUri="{Binding Path}">
        <TextBlock Text="{Binding Path=Path}" />
    </Hyperlink>
</TextBlock>

It looks strange, but it works. We do it in about 20 different places in our app. Hyperlink implicitly constructs a <Run/> if you put text in its "content", but in .NET 3.5 <Run/> won't let you bind to it, so you've got to explicitly use a TextBlock.

<TextBlock>
    <Hyperlink Command="local:MyCommands.ViewDetails" CommandParameter="{Binding}">
        <TextBlock Text="{Binding Path=Name}"/>
    </Hyperlink>
</TextBlock>

Update: Note that as of .NET 4.0 the Run.Text property can now be bound:

<Run Text="{Binding Path=Name}" />
